The main difference between autotrophs and heterotrophs lies in their modes of obtaining energy and nutrients. Autotrophs, such as plants and some bacteria, produce their own food through processes like photosynthesis or chemosynthesis, using inorganic substances and sunlight. In contrast, heterotrophs, including animals and fungi, rely on consuming organic matter from other organisms for energy and nutrients. Essentially, autotrophs are self-sustaining, while heterotrophs depend on others for sustenance.

Chemolithoautotrophs use inorganic compounds as an energy source in chemosynthesis, while photoautotrophs use sunlight as an energy source in photosynthesis. This difference in energy source influences the way these organisms produce organic molecules for growth and development.
